Why multicloud matters
Enterprises choose multicloud to avoid vendor lock-in, optimize for price and performance, and leverage specialized services across providers.
Hybrid cloud remains essential for workloads that require low-latency access to on-site data, regulatory isolation, or gradual cloud migration.
The combined approach lets teams place each workload where it runs best while maintaining a consistent governance posture.
Key challenges to address
– Cost sprawl: Uncoordinated resources across providers lead to wasteful duplication and unmanaged spend.
– Operational complexity: Multiple tooling sets, IAM models, and deployment pipelines increase friction.
– Security and compliance: Inconsistent policies and telemetry gaps create blind spots.
– Data gravity and egress: Moving large datasets between environments can be slow and expensive.

Practical recommendations
– Establish a central cloud governance framework: Define shared policies for identity, tagging, cost allocation, data classification, and encryption. Use policy-as-code to enforce standards across clouds and on-prem systems.
– Adopt a single pane of glass for visibility: Consolidated dashboards for usage, costs, and security alerts reduce mean time to detect and respond. Many third-party platforms integrate with multiple providers and offer normalized metrics and alerts.
– Tag consistently and early: Implement a mandatory tagging taxonomy for projects, teams, environments, and cost centers. Tags are the foundation for chargeback, reporting, and lifecycle automation.
– Prioritize platform-level consistency: Standardize CI/CD pipelines, container runtimes, and observability stacks.
Kubernetes can help unify deployment across clouds, but ensure teams standardize configurations and operators to avoid drift.
– Optimize data placement: Keep high-throughput or latency-sensitive data close to compute.
Use caching, replication, or edge caching to reduce cross-region or cross-provider egress charges.
– Automate cost controls: Set budget alerts, use rightsizing recommendations, implement autoscaling, and consider committed-use or savings plans when consumption patterns justify them.
Use automated policies to shut down nonproduction assets outside business hours.
Security and compliance best practices
– Centralize identity: Integrate cloud accounts with a single identity provider and enforce multifactor authentication and least-privilege access.
– Shift-left security: Embed security in pipelines through automated scanning, IaC policy checks, and container image validation.
– Unified logging and tracing: Forward logs and traces to a centralized observability layer for consistent forensic and compliance workflows.
– Continuous posture management: Run continuous configuration checks against benchmarks and remediate noncompliant resources automatically.
When to simplify
Not every workload needs multicloud. Evaluate candidate workloads based on data gravity, latency needs, specialized services required, and operational overhead.
For teams new to cloud, starting with a single provider and introducing portability patterns later often reduces early complexity and cost.
